Fireproofing Your Metal Garage for Safety and Insurance Compliance

A metal garage offers durability and low maintenance compared to many traditional building materials. However, while metal structures are noncombustible, they are not automatically fireproof. Heat can weaken metal. Stored items can ignite. Poor planning can turn a garage into a serious fire hazard. Fireproofing a metal garage is not only about protecting property but also about safeguarding lives and meeting insurance requirements that can affect coverage and premiums.

As fire safety standards become more rigorous, homeowners and property managers are expected to take proactive measures to reduce fire risk. Insurance companies increasingly assess how well garages are protected against fire before determining policy terms. Strengthening fire resistance in a metal garage can improve safety, reduce liability, and ensure compliance with building codes and insurer expectations, all while preserving the value of the structure.

How Do Fire Risks Commonly Start in Garages

Garage fires often begin due to electrical faults, improper storage of flammable liquids, unattended power tools, or malfunctioning appliances. Welding, grinding, and other mechanical work can also produce sparks that ignite combustible materials.

Fuel spills, oily rags, and cluttered storage increase the likelihood of fire spreading rapidly. Poor ventilation can trap heat and fumes, creating an environment where a small spark escalates into a dangerous blaze. Understanding these risks is the first step toward implementing effective fireproofing strategies.

What Role Does Insulation Play in Fire Resistance

Insulation is a key factor in controlling heat transfer and slowing fire spread. Fire-rated insulation materials such as mineral wool or fire-resistant foam can help contain heat and prevent flames from reaching structural components.

Using insulation with a high fire resistance rating provides an added layer of protection while improving energy efficiency. Properly installed insulation can delay structural failure, giving occupants more time to respond and reducing overall damage.

How Can Fire-Rated Wall and Ceiling Panels Improve Safety

Installing fire-rated wall and ceiling panels enhances the garage’s ability to withstand high temperatures. Materials such as fire-resistant drywall, cement board, or treated metal panels can help prevent flames from spreading quickly.

These panels act as thermal barriers that slow heat penetration and protect critical structural elements. Upgrading interior surfaces with fire-rated materials is a practical step toward improving safety and meeting insurance standards.

Why Is Proper Storage of Flammable Materials Essential

One of the most effective fire prevention measures is the proper storage of flammable substances. Gasoline, propane tanks, paint, and chemicals should be stored in approved containers and kept away from heat sources.

Designated storage cabinets designed for flammable materials offer additional protection by limiting exposure to sparks and high temperatures. Keeping hazardous substances organized and isolated reduces the risk of accidental ignition.

How Do Electrical Systems Contribute to Fire Safety

Faulty wiring is a common cause of garage fires. Ensuring that electrical systems are installed and maintained according to code is critical for fire prevention. Overloaded outlets, damaged cords, and outdated panels can create dangerous conditions.

Hiring a licensed electrician to inspect wiring, upgrade circuit breakers, and install ground fault protection improves safety. Using certified fixtures and avoiding makeshift electrical solutions reduces the likelihood of electrical-related fires.

What Fire-Resistant Flooring Options Are Available

Flooring materials can influence how a fire spreads and how easy it is to manage spills or combustible debris. Concrete floors are highly fire-resistant and easy to clean, making them an ideal choice for metal garages.

Applying fire-resistant coatings or sealants can further enhance durability and safety. These finishes help contain spills, reduce dust accumulation, and make it easier to remove flammable residues that could ignite.

How Can Fire-Rated Doors Improve Protection

Fire-rated doors are designed to resist heat and flames for a specified period, helping to contain fires within a confined space. Installing fire-rated doors between a garage and the main building reduces the risk of fire spreading into living areas.

Sealed door frames and self-closing mechanisms improve performance by preventing smoke and heat from escaping. This upgrade is often recommended or required by building codes and insurance providers.

Why Is Ventilation Important for Fire Prevention

Proper ventilation helps prevent the buildup of heat, fumes, and combustible vapors. Garages that store vehicles or fuel-producing equipment benefit from well-designed airflow systems that disperse flammable gases.

Installing vents, exhaust fans, or louvered openings reduces the concentration of volatile substances. Effective ventilation also improves air quality and reduces the likelihood of explosive conditions.

How Do Fire Suppression Systems Enhance Safety

Fire suppression systems provide an active line of defense against fires. Sprinkler systems, fire extinguishers, and fire blankets can limit damage and improve response time during an emergency.

Keeping fire extinguishers accessible and properly maintained ensures quick action in case of ignition. For larger garages or commercial properties, installing automatic suppression systems can significantly reduce fire-related losses.

How Can Fire-Resistant Coatings Protect Metal Surfaces

Applying intumescent or fire-resistant coatings to metal surfaces helps protect structural integrity during a fire. These coatings expand when exposed to heat, forming an insulating layer that slows temperature rise.

Fire-resistant paint and sealants are commonly used in industrial and residential settings to improve fire performance. Investing in protective coatings extends the life of the structure while enhancing safety compliance.

Why Is Structural Reinforcement Important in Fire Scenarios

Extreme heat can weaken metal framing, causing deformation or collapse. Reinforcing structural components with fire-resistant materials helps maintain stability during a fire.

Using thicker gauge steel, adding protective cladding, or installing fire-resistant barriers enhances structural resilience. These measures provide additional time for evacuation and emergency response.

How Can Exterior Fireproofing Reduce Risk from Nearby Fires

External fire threats, such as wildfires or neighboring property fires, can impact a metal garage. Applying fire-resistant siding, roofing, and perimeter landscaping reduces vulnerability.

Clearing vegetation and maintaining defensible space around the structure limits exposure to external flames. Exterior fireproofing strengthens overall resilience and protects against environmental risks.
